Default 100cc Yak Maiden

Got out today and had the maiden flight with my Yak. What another great plane from Aeroworks. I love the way this color scheme presents itself in the air. It really stands out. Everyone at the field commented on how well it stands out and is easy to see, It does very nice knife edge with just a hair of elevator and roll coupling. I would say about 3% elevator and not enough roll to worry about. I didn't program in a mix today as it is easy to control it with the sticks.Snap rolls and tumbling are a blast. Ended up putting on about 8 or 9 flights. On one of the flights one of the servo screws fell out. No problem I just came in and landed without anygrief. Oops I forgot to locktite one of them.
